Abstract

There is increasing concern about the potential impact of global climate changes, which significantly affect ambient temperature, on plant growth and development. Especially, the floral transition (vegetative phase to reproductive phase) is an important process in the life cycle of flowering plants, because their reproductive success depends on it. To determine the right timing of flowering, plants respond to many environmental signals such as day length and temperature. Even small changes in ambient temperature also control flowering process, although our understanding of the genetic and molecular mechanisms underlying this flowering pathway (ambient temperature pathway or thermosensory pathway) is still limited. However, recent advances in Arabidopsis have uncovered the various molecular mechanisms regulating ambient temperature-responsive flowering. Today, I introduce the molecular mechanisms involved in SHORT VEGETATIVE PHASE(SVP), FLOWERING LOCUS M(FLM), miRNAs, and others under ambient temperature conditions.
